Transaction c2685062f717422a38263093a94af726a38ae51f0255573831d50a54d6a683ba
1 Input
1 Output
-
c2685062f717422a38263093a94af726a38ae51f0255573831d50a54d6a683ba:0
- value
- 1398516
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6eef71d1dda7edc120987ac87baf41909efc5d1f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1B7aB1FqxRZqzpy5siZ6wEqDCWMrJ6btQL